Administrative days in acute care facilities: a queueing-analytic approach.
Operations Research
|December 11, 1986
Summary
Patients face extended hospital stays due to delays in accessing nursing homes or home health care. This study models these administrative days to understand patient flow and inform policy.

Background:
- Patients often remain in acute care hospitals after medical needs are met, awaiting extended care services.
- This prolonged stay, termed "administrative days," is due to non-medical, administrative reasons.
- Understanding the dynamics of patient flow during this transition is crucial for healthcare efficiency.
Purpose of the Study:
- To model the patient placement process for extended care services from acute care facilities.
- To analyze the factors influencing the duration of administrative days.
- To provide insights into the policy implications of patient flow management.
Main Methods:
- Employed a queueing-analytic approach to describe patient awaiting placement.
- Developed a model with a state-dependent placement rate for patients awaiting transfer.
- Validated model results using data from seven hospitals in New York State.
Main Results:
- The queueing model effectively describes the process of patients awaiting extended care placement.
- State-dependent placement rates were analyzed in relation to patient backup in acute facilities.
- Model predictions were compared against empirical data from sampled hospitals.
Conclusions:
- The study provides a quantitative framework for understanding administrative days in hospitals.
- The findings highlight the impact of administrative processes on patient flow and hospital capacity.
- Policy recommendations can be informed by the insights gained from the queueing-analytic model.
